So im having trouble assigning employees to different departments at my work.

Say theres 12 employees and 4 different departments (A,B,C,D).

Some days 3 people are working in each department. Randomly assigning that would be easy. However, most days, department A only needs 2 people or department D needs 4. Some days one department wont be running at all.

Ive been messing with Rand() roundbetween rank, but i cant seem to figure out how to do this with differing group sizes. Is there a way i can input how many people i need in each department and have it randomize the right number of employees for each department based on my necessity??

Even a nudge in the right direction would be great. Im ignorant. Thanks in advance!

Here are two examples :

Formula description.

\$G7 = Staff no in each department.
\$C\$4:\$C\$15 = Range of staff name.
\$D\$4:\$D\$15 = Range of random value.

Regards.

Awesome. Exactly what i was talking about. Thank you!

You are welcome.

